Electric Guitar

  • Body: Mahogany
  • Top: Flamed maple
  • Set-in neck: Mahogany
  • Fretboard: Macassar ebony
  • Neck profile: Thin U
  • Fretboard binding
  • 24 Jumbo frets
  • Scale: 629 mm (24.76")
  • Fretboard radius: 350 mm (13.78")
  • Nut width: 42 mm (1.65")
  • Cast nut
  • Pickup: 1 Seymour Duncan Pegasus (bridge) and 1 Seymour Duncan Sentient (neck) humbucker
  • 2 Volume controls
  • 1 Tone control with push/pull function
  • 3-Way toggle switch
  • Tonepros Locking TOM bridge & tailpiece
  • LTD locking machine heads
  • Black hardware
  • Ex-factory stringing: D'Addario XL110 .010 - .046
  • Colour: Black Natural Burst

Great sound, fast neck and beautiful looks
Pranet 14.02.2026
I’m overall impressed buy this guitar, especially how comfortable it is to play fast riffs. Ofc, the sound tight and gives a good chug however, slightly upset with QC. Bridge volume knob is a bit wobbly (works fine). Also, there was clicking sounds from TOM bridge and the nut when bending the high strings (setup issues).

LTD did not do a great job with this one
Mr.Gandalf 24.05.2024
I ordered this guitar because I was enthusiatic about the full thickness body and the cool finish Black Natural Burst, but unfortunatelly I had to send it back due to the bad QC. I will mention this is not the fault of Thomann , actually they have been most helpfull with providing return documentation. The guitar to my surprise was a Korean production but came with a chipped fretboard at the first fret position probably who worked on it inserted the tool to deep and also upon deeper inspection I noticed that the bridge was not inserted fully into the body, and this can cause terrible intonation problems. LTD has a hit and miss problem lately, becasue I have also an LTD Eclipse NT87 and that guitar is top notch. I only hope LTD will make the QC team to be more detail oriented because you cannot have this type of errors on a Pro level Guitar. 10 stars for Thomann and their Customer support!
